Endi "szépészeti beavatkozásokat" van kedved csinálni a programon?
Pl a
420 IF MAINY<0 THEN LET MAINY=0
430 IF MAINY>10 THEN LET MAINY=10
szerkezet helyett gyorsabb és rövidebb a
420 LET MAINY=MAX(MAINY,0)
430 LET MAINY=MIN(MAINY,10)
Pár ilyen a programban:
1030 LET ACTPAL=MAX(ACTPAL,1)
1040 LET ACTPAL=MIN(ACTPAL,32)
3130 LET EX=MAX(EX,1)
3140 LET EX=MIN(EX,8)
3150 LET EY=MAX(EY,18)
3160 LET EY=MIN(EY,18)
további programsorok:
2170
2180
2190
2200
4120
4030
4140
4150
4160
4170
5210
5220
6500
6510
6520
6530
persze lehet, hogy több is van.
IS-BASIC-ben megengedett, hogy egyszerre több változónak adjunk értéket:
2450 LET EX=2: LET EY=3: LET EI=1: LET ANIM=1
helyett:
2450 LET EX=2: LET EY=3: LET EI,ANIM=1